Position Overview:
This position supports key stakeholders by delivering reports, major gift prospect recommendations and prospect pipeline insights to university administrators. They establish and execute regular data audits to enhance prospect management data quality for portfolio management and organizational reporting. Additionally, they analyze accumulated data to assess and facilitate the identification of new major gift prospects for the university.
Duties may include:
- Monitor contact report submissions to ensure compliance with internal policies and standards
- Compile and distribute prospect management reports, rate prospects, assign prospects to development officers, and collaborate on strategy development and performance analysis
- Provide specialized research data to development officers and fundraisers for qualifying, cultivating and soliciting donations
- Analyze prospect data for giving potential, inclination, linkage to major gifts, and philanthropic capacity
- Assist in developing cultivation and solicitation strategies based on prospect assessments
- Other duties as assigned
